Founded in 1911, the University of Hong Kong is committed to the highest international standards of excellence in teaching and research, and has been at the international forefront of academic scholarship for many years. The University has a comprehensive range of study programmes and research disciplines spread across 10 faculties and over 140 academic departments and institutes/centres. There are 28,000 undergraduate and postgraduate students who are recruited globally, and more than 2,000 members of academic and academic-related staff coming from multi-cultural backgrounds, many of whom are internationally renowned.
Non-Tenure Track Professor of Practice/Tenure-Track Professor/Associate Professor in Public Policy in the University of Southern California's Sol Price School of Public Policy and the Faculty of Social Sciences of the University of Hong Kong (Ref.: 201600275)
The University of Southern California's Sol Price School of Public Policy and the Faculty of Social Sciences of the University of Hong Kong are seeking an untenured Professor of Practice or tenured associate or full professor in global public policy. The successful candidate could be based at either USC, HKU or jointly. International experience and knowledge of East-West comparative approaches to public policy issues are desirable.  He/She will be expected to teach within the Master of Global Public Policy program. Applicants must hold a Ph.D. in public policy or related fields. For tenured appointments, an excellent research record is expected.
The successful candidate will be expected to lead the USC/HKU Master of Global Public Policy, which is scheduled to be launched in June 2017.  He/She will have exceptional management and leadership skills, and will oversee all areas of operation of the program, including promotional activities, public relations, and curriculum development and coordination between the two partner institutions.
About the University of Southern California's Sol Price School:
The mission of the Price School is to improve the quality of life for people and their communities, here and abroad. We achieve this mission through education and research that promote innovative solutions to the most critical issues facing society, with a particular focus on governance, urban development, and social policy. The Price School offers Ph.D. programs in Public Policy and Management and in Urban Planning and Development; masters' degrees in Public Administration, Nonprofit Leadership and Management, Public Policy, Urban Planning, Health Administration, and Real Estate Development; executive masters' degrees; and an interdisciplinary undergraduate degree.  For additional information, see our website: www.usc.edu/schools/price/.
About the Faculty of Social Sciences of the University of Hong Kong:
The mission of the Faculty of Social Sciences is to contribute to the advancement of society and the development of leaders through a global presence, regional significance and engagement with the rest of China.  We seek to establish a world-leading public policy programme that conducts cutting-edge research, provides innovative teaching and training, and offers novel solutions to local, regional, and global problems. The Faculty consists of five academic departments and seven multidisciplinary research centres. In addition to the Ph.D. and M.Phil. degrees offered by all departments, taught postgraduate degrees in public administration, transport policy and planning, nonprofit management and other areas are also offered.
